With the end of the year in sight, it's a good time to remind everyone that our license with Stockade Miniatures and their Soldiers of the World line ends December 31.

After that, we will no longer offer unpainted metal castings of essential Napoleonic sets like French Cuirassiers and Carabiniers, foot artillery, Voltigeurs, and Royal Horse Artillery.

I believe those metal figures will thereafter be available only from Regal Miniatures of New Zealand as pre-painted collector models. Get the unpainted castings while they last on the ATKM Napoleonics page.

These are all 54mm metal miniatures suitable for wargaming and displays. Yes, you can wargame mass battles in 54mm. Check out the All the King's Men wargame rules as a free PDF.
